Transaction 62290c61c71ceadf43e0b5db28b121cbed07e4f6620fb121ca0b03d5e526d91b
1 Input
1 Output
-
62290c61c71ceadf43e0b5db28b121cbed07e4f6620fb121ca0b03d5e526d91b:0
- value
- 429548
- script pubkey
- OP_0 OP_PUSHBYTES_20 d594c5e1927f9b5079be2f3630ea8714b0d644f0
- address
- bc1q6k2vtcvj07d4q7d79umrp658zjcdv38s8dq5qd